Key Components of an Effective Edge Protection System
Effective edge protection systems rely on several critical components working together seamlessly to guarantee the safety of people and assets.
We recognize that the Indian government's emphasis on safety regulations is driven by a desire to protect our nation's most valuable resource – our people.
Protecting our nation's most valuable resource – our people – is the driving force behind India's stringent safety regulations.
To confirm adherence, we must focus on the key components that make an edge protection system truly effective.
- Guardrails: A sturdy guardrail system is the first line of defense against falls, providing a physical barrier to prevent accidents.
- Safety nets: Strategically placed safety nets can catch falling workers or objects, minimizing damage and injury.
- Cable systems: Cable systems provide a stable anchor point for workers to attach their personal fall protection equipment.
- Warning systems: Visual and audible warning systems alert workers to potential hazards, confirming they take necessary precautions.

Material Selection and Testing for Edge Protection Systems
Selecting the right materials for our edge protection systems is crucial to guaranteeing their reliability and performance.
We must choose materials that can withstand the harsh Indian environment and extreme weather conditions. This includes exposure to heavy rainfall, intense sunlight, and extreme temperatures.
When selecting materials, we consider the following factors:
- Corrosion resistance: Our materials must be able to resist corrosion from exposure to moisture and chemicals.
- Durability: We choose materials that can withstand the test of time and maintain their strength and integrity.
- Load-bearing capacity: Our edge protection systems must be able to support the weight of people, equipment, and other loads.
- Compliance with Indian standards: We verify that our materials meet or exceed the safety standards set by the Indian government.

Competency Assessment Criteria
Developing a robust competency assessment criteria is crucial to guarantee that users of edge protection systems possess the necessary skills and knowledge to operate safely and efficiently.
As we endeavor to verify compliance with Indian safety regulations, we must establish a clear framework for evaluating the competence of our users. This involves appraising their understanding of edge protection systems, their ability to identify hazards, and their capacity to respond to emergencies.
We believe the following criteria are essential for an exhaustive competency assessment:
- Theoretical knowledge: Users must demonstrate a thorough understanding of edge protection systems, including their components, functionality, and limitations.
- Practical skills: Users must be able to install, inspect, and maintain edge protection systems correctly.
- Risk assessment and management: Users must be able to identify potential hazards and implement effective risk management strategies.
- Emergency response: Users must know how to respond promptly and effectively in emergency situations.
